Key International Regulations Governing Maritime Safety

International regulations governing maritime safety are primarily established through treaties and conventions developed by global organizations to promote safety and standardization across maritime activities. The International Maritime Organization (IMO) plays a central role in this framework, setting binding standards that member states are encouraged to adopt. These standards cover vessel construction, equipment, and operational procedures to prevent accidents and safeguard lives at sea.

Key international regulations include the International Convention for the Safety of Life at Sea (SOLAS), which establishes minimum safety standards for ship design, construction, and equipment. Another vital regulation is the International Convention on Standards of Training, Certification and Watchkeeping for Seafarers (STCW), which ensures that crew members possess adequate skills and qualifications. The IMO also oversees the Marine Pollution Convention (MARPOL), which addresses environmental safety alongside maritime safety standards.

These regulations work collectively to streamline safety practices worldwide, fostering international cooperation and compliance. While individual countries implement and enforce these standards through national regulations, adherence facilitates safer maritime operations across different jurisdictions. Ensuring compliance with these key international regulations is crucial for promoting maritime safety and protecting human life and the environment at sea.

National Maritime Safety Regulations and Their Alignment with Global Standards

National maritime safety regulations vary significantly across countries, yet many aim to align closely with international standards to ensure consistency and safety. Countries often adapt global treaties, such as SOLAS (International Convention for the Safety of Life at Sea), into their national legal frameworks. This alignment helps facilitate international trade and navigation by creating a universally understood safety baseline.

For example, the United States Coast Guard enforces regulations that incorporate IMO (International Maritime Organization) standards, ensuring vessels operating in U.S. waters meet international safety criteria. Similarly, the European Union has adopted directives that harmonize with IMO conventions, promoting seamless safety protocols across member states. These national frameworks not only integrate global safety standards but also tailor regulations to address specific regional safety concerns.

While most countries strive to remain consistent with global standards, discrepancies can occur due to differing legal systems or safety priorities. Nonetheless, ongoing international cooperation fosters harmonization efforts, enhancing maritime safety worldwide. Such alignment is vital for ensuring that vessels and crews adhere to consistent safety practices, thereby reducing risks of maritime accidents and environmental hazards.

United States Coast Guard regulations

The United States Coast Guard (USCG) regulations serve as a comprehensive framework for maritime safety within U.S. waters. They establish standards for vessel construction, operation, and maintenance to ensure mariner safety and environmental protection. These regulations are legally enforceable and align closely with international maritime safety standards.

The regulations cover various vessel categories, including commercial ships, passenger boats, and recreational vessels. Key areas include stability criteria, life-saving equipment, navigation procedures, and pollution prevention measures. The USCG mandates adherence to these standards through certification and inspection processes.

To ensure compliance, vessels must undergo regular inspections and obtain certifications such as the Certificate of Inspection (COI). The USCG also enforces safety management systems, requiring vessel operators to implement risk assessments and safety protocols. These measures promote a high standard of safety across all maritime activities in U.S. waters.

Some specific requirements include the following:

  • Vessel stability and structural integrity standards
  • Mandatory safety equipment and life-saving devices
  • Crew qualifications and safety training programs
  • Pollution prevention and waste disposal regulations

Safety Zones, Navigational Aids, and Marine Traffic Management

Safety zones are designated areas around critical maritime structures, such as harbors, oil rigs, and accident-prone regions, aimed at minimizing risks and ensuring safe navigation. These zones are established under international and national regulations to prevent maritime accidents.

Navigational aids are devices and signals, including buoys, lighthouses, radar systems, and electronic chart displays, that assist vessels in determining their position and navigating safely. They are integral to maritime safety standards and regulations, facilitating accurate and reliable navigation across complex or adverse conditions.

Marine traffic management encompasses strategies and systems to oversee vessel movements, reduce congestion, and prevent collisions. This involves mechanisms such as traffic separation schemes, Vessel Traffic Services (VTS), and traffic monitoring centers, which operate under strict compliance with international safety regulations.

Key elements of marine traffic management include:

  • Designation of safety zones for hazardous areas or busy channels.
  • Deployment of navigational aids to enhance maritime situational awareness.
  • Coordination through marine traffic monitoring to optimize vessel routes and prevent accidents.

Together, safety zones, navigational aids, and marine traffic management form the backbone of maritime safety standards and regulations, ensuring orderly and secure maritime operations globally.

Case Studies of Maritime Safety Incidents and Lessons Learned

Analyzing maritime safety incidents provides critical lessons for improving current standards and regulations. Notable cases, such as the Exxon Valdez oil spill in 1989, highlight the importance of rigorous safety management and risk assessment procedures. The spill resulted from human error and inadequate navigational safeguards, leading to severe environmental damage and legal repercussions. This incident underscored the need for stricter adherence to safety standards and the implementation of advanced navigational technology.

Another significant example is the Costa Concordia disaster in 2012. The cruise ship struck a rock off the Italian coast, primarily due to insufficient emergency preparedness and poor crew response. The tragedy prompted a review of safety management and emergency response procedures, emphasizing the importance of comprehensive training and safety drills. These lessons contributed to worldwide improvements in emergency preparedness regulations.

These case studies demonstrate that failures in safety standards can have devastating environmental, economic, and human costs. They reinforce the importance of ongoing review, enforcement, and adaptation of maritime safety regulations to prevent future incidents. Learning from such incidents helps shape robust policies aligned with the evolving maritime environment.
